Note1) The transmission distance varies according to the used cable and type of unit.
Note2) The advanced units that occur interrupt are as follows. - Interrupt unit
- High-speed counter unit and Pulse output unit can be used when setting to the mode that does not
occur interrupt.
- As there is no indication for the error that a prohibited unit is installed on FP2 A/D unit, D/A unit and
RTD unit, no error indication will be displayed, even If they are installed incorrectly.
Note3) When using a positioning unit for FP2 slave station system, and If the time taken from the start-
up to the completion of positioning operation is shorter than the scan time, flags such as the output end
flag and pulse output flag may not be read and an error may occur.The time from the start-up to the
completion of positioning operation must be longer than the scan time.
